Noun Project Map icon 1463108.svgPhysical geography
An overview of climate, topography and landscape of the country. It is advised to also create a sketch, you can add a link to this (hosted on imgur or similar)


The country has a cold climate and very little access to the sea. For this reason, the countries biggest urban and port cities will be situated in the far south-east in the small inlet of Kaspen Sea.

Additionally, most of the landlocked borders will be mountainous and alpine climate. Expect to see many ski resort and alpine passes in these areas.

Moving further inland, there is a large forest and national park area towards the middle and vast farmland and rural area will fill the flatter terrain around it. There are also a number of large lakes throughout.

Invest - The Noun Project.svgHuman geography
A brief description of the territory demographics, economic development, land occupation, infrastructure and mapping style


Previously stated the biggest urban and port cities will be situated in the far south-east in the small inlet of Kaspen Sea. A few more major, but smaller cities exist throughout which will be connected by motorway and railway. Along these routes will also be small and quaint rural towns, villages and hamlets.

In the alpine regions will be ski villages and resorts which will be accessible by road and sometimes rail. These are sort of Scandinavian-inspired.

The mapping style will loosely resemble British, with aspects of other European countries. Driving side is on the left.
